GREENWOOD (CHARLES and JOHN) Map of London, from an Actual Survey made in the Years 1824, 1825, and 1826, large map on 6 sheets engraved by James and Josiah Neele, large calligraphic title and dedication to George IV with Royal arms, fine inset views of Westminster Abbey and St Paul's Cathedral [Howgego 309 (1)], each sheet approx 620 x 615mm., Greenwood, Pringle, 1827
Sold for £4,800 inc. premium
